Position Summary

Power TakeOff is seeking a Senior Strategic Energy Management Coach to work with commercial businesses across the U.S. to drive energy efficiency and foster a culture of continuous energy improvement.


The Strategic Energy Management Coach position is central to our utility programs. Coaches develop energy saving measures through smart meter data analysis, guiding participants to make persistent operational and behavioral energy-saving changes. Customer engagement, strategic planning, and implementation is completed entirely through virtual meetings and workshops with support from our technical team as needed.

Energy Management Planning and Execution

      Conducting baseline assessments of current energy practices

      Developing energy action plans with site-specific goals and prioritized actions

      Collaborating with customers to implement low- and no-cost energy-saving measures

      Collaborating with Power TakeOff’s Technical team to identify and implement low- and no-cost energy savings measures with customers

      Supporting ongoing goal setting and tracking through regular performance reviews

Data-Driven Decision Making

      Achieve kWh savings goals as outlined by the team

      Analyzing interval electricity usage data (15-, 30-, and 60-minute resolution)

      Identifying key drivers of energy use and opportunities for savings

      Partnering with M&V teams to evaluate and communicate performance results

      Drafting monthly updates, year-end reports, and success stories
